On a more serious note, these knives are fantastic. Some of you have heard it all before...;) ...but I will say it again..

"They are lighter than I expected, the handles are 100% more comfortable than EVER described by anybody...the blade width seems wider than the CG Busse's (??? without measuring them, it certainly feels wider), the finger choil is an excellent size, the crinkle coat still rocks, I was expecting handles something like on the cold steel knives I guess, but man, was I wrong!!! These handles take all the shock absorbtion and are that damn comfortable, I may use one as a pillow tonight. The penatrator tip is awesome (but yet to be used, it looks good!).......I just LOVE these knives and I am not a big fan of 'rubberised' style handles...they do not seem to be rubberised though, but rather 'gooey' - I like it!
